From 7de4d74a44b392edd384288f9c24c18ef80331af Mon Sep 17 00:00:00 2001 From: Robert Wiesner Date: Sun, 27 Nov 2022 09:56:14 +0100 Subject: [PATCH] [FIX] Detekt Add --add-opens java.base/java.lang=ALL-UNNAMED - With the upgrade from openjdk@11 to openjdk@17 the formula breaks when running detekt - See https://github.com/Homebrew/homebrew-core/issues/116784 --- Formula/detekt.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Formula/detekt.rb b/Formula/detekt.rb index b95ac1876466..01fb057e2b65 100644 --- a/Formula/detekt.rb +++ b/Formula/detekt.rb @@ -18,7 +18,7 @@ class Detekt < Formula def install libexec.install "detekt-cli-#{version}-all.jar" - bin.write_jar_script libexec/"detekt-cli-#{version}-all.jar", "detekt", java_version: "17" + bin.write_jar_script libexec/"detekt-cli-#{version}-all.jar", "detekt", "--add-opens java.base/java.lang=ALL-UNNAMED", java_version: "17" end test do